2006 Kansas Code - 41-712

      41-712.   Days and hours of sale by retailers. (a) Within any city where the days of sale at retail of alcoholic liquor in the original package have not been expanded as provided by K.S.A. 2005 Supp. 41-2911, and amendments thereto, or have been so expanded and subsequently restricted as provided by K.S.A. 2005 Supp. 41-2911, and amendments thereto, and within any township where the days of sale at retail of alcoholic liquor in the original package have not been expanded as provided by K.S.A. 2005 Supp 41-2911, and amendments thereto, or have been so expanded and subsequently restricted as provided by K.S.A. 2005 Supp. 41-2911, and amendments thereto, no person shall sell at retail any alcoholic liquor in the original package: (1) On Sunday; (2) on Memorial Day, Independence Day, Labor Day, Thanksgiving Day or Christmas Day; or (3) before 9 a.m. or after 11 p.m. on any day when the sale is permitted. The governing body of any city by ordinance may require the closing of premises prior to 11 p.m., but such ordinance shall not require closing prior to 8 p.m.

      (b)   Within any city where the days of sale at retail of alcoholic liquor in the original package have been expanded as provided by K.S.A. 2005 Supp. 41-2911, and amendments thereto, and have not been subsequently restricted as provided by K.S.A. 2005 Supp. 41-2911, and amendments thereto, and within any township where the days of sale at retail of alcoholic liquor in the original package have been expanded as provided by K.S.A. 2005 Supp. 41-2911, and amendments thereto, and have not been subsequently restricted as provided by K.S.A. 2005 Supp. 41-2911, and amendments thereto, no person shall sell at retail alcoholic liquor in the original package: (1) On Sunday before 12 noon or after 8 p.m.; (2) on Easter Sunday, Thanksgiving Day or Christmas Day; or (3) before 9 a.m. or after 11 p.m. on any day when the sale is permitted. The governing body of any city by ordinance may require the closing of premises prior to 11 p.m., but such ordinance shall not require closing prior to 8 p.m.

      History:   L. 1949, ch. 242, § 75; L. 1994, ch. 166, § 1; L. 2005, ch. 201, § 8; Nov. 15.
